Judge Allison D. Burroughs: ORDER entered. SERVICE ORDER re 2241 Petition. Response is due by May 12, 2025. Unless otherwise ordered by the Court, petitioner shall not be moved outside the District of Massachusetts without first providing advance notice of the intended move. Such notice shall be filed in writing on the docket in this proceeding, and shall state the reason why the government believes that such a movement is necessary and should not be stayed pending further court proceedings. Once that notice has been docketed, the petitioner shall not be moved out of the District for a period of at least 48 hours from the time of that docketing. (jm) (Entered: 04/28/2025)
